Description & Estimates







Public records show 62, Selworthy Road, Birmingham to be a mid-century freehold house with 796 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 210 m2 plot.
In this area,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
62, Selworthy Road, Birmingham has an estimated sale value of £259,615 and an estimated rental value of £1,297 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.
Selworthy Road, Birmingham, B36 lies in the borough of Solihull, within the B36 postal district.

Energy Efficiency
62, Selworthy Road, Birming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 11 Jul 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
